Abstract
This paper designed and demonstrated a single-mode fiber scanning OCT catheter/endoscope. This device is an enabling technology for OCT and will permit micron scale, cross-sectional medical diagnostic imaging in tissues such as the vascular system, the gastrointestinal tract, the urinary tract, and the ability to perform optical biopsy, to image the microstructure of tissues in situ without the need for excision, should have a significant impact on medical diagnosis and the management of disease.
